“The Lord is able to give you much more than this” (2 Chron. 25:9 NKV).
How often are we willing to settle for less than God’s best for our lives? Sometimes when a step of faith requires some real effort, it seems easier to give in to pressure and accept substandard arrangements or provision.
This verse assures us that the Lord is trying to raise our sights in order to raise our levels.
Whatever you may have in life right now, the Lord is able to give you much more than this. His plans for you, if accepted and implemented by you, will improve your quality of life.
Good will become better. Better will become best. God is able to do much more for you. Best of all. He is willing to do it. All it takes is faith.
But faith is not a struggle to convince your “spirit” of something your mind knows is really not so. It’s not saying “I believe” over and over until you “psyche” yourself into believing by force of sheer repetition. Faith is not brainwashing or mouth wishing.
Simply stated, faith is more than believing God.
We have all heard of the great faith of Abraham. Yet what he did, we can all do: …Abraham believed God, and it was counted to him for righteousness (Rom 4:3). Abraham became known as the “father of faith.” Why? Because of his attitude and actions – before him whom he believed, even God… (v. 17).
The Lord is able to give you much more than this. If you have faith – if you believe God – then take Him at His Word. Do what Abraham did: Believe God, agree with God, obey God. Do that, and you will receive “much more than this” from Him! Amen!

Dick Mills was ordained at The International Church of the Foursquare Gospel in 1949. He and his wife Betty traveled as evangelists all over the United States, Canada, Mexico, Latin America, Europe, and Australia. Dick and Betty are now home in heaven.
In 1966 Dick and Betty became a part of the then-emerging Charismatic Renewal. Passing through all denominational barriers, Dick has had the opportunity to speak in thousands of churches of varied backgrounds all over the world.
He ministered within several Christian organizations, including the Full Gospel Business Men, Women's Aglow, Inter-church Renewal Catholic Pentecostals, mainline Charismatic groups, CBN and TBN television networks, and many other independent Christian TV stations.
Dick appeared on numerous radio talk shows, written several magazine articles, and spoke at many Bible conferences and universities. He served as an adjunct professor at six Schools of the Bible and Seminaries.
In addition, Dick authored and co-authored several books and tapes. Dick's ministry was characterized by the unique gifts God has blessed him with. His services informed, enlightened, and motivated people to a higher level of commitment to God.
